PCI DSS Requirements (12 Core Requirements)

Build and Maintain Secure Network

  1. Install and maintain firewall configuration
  2. Don't use vendor-supplied defaults for passwords

Protect Cardholder Data

  1. Protect stored cardholder data
  2. Encrypt transmission of cardholder data across public networks

Maintain Vulnerability Management

  1. Protect systems against malware
  2. Develop and maintain secure systems and applications

Implement Strong Access Control

  1. Restrict access to cardholder data by business need-to-know
  2. Identify and authenticate access to system components
  3. Restrict physical access to cardholder data

Monitor and Test Networks

  1. Track and monitor all access to network resources and cardholder data
  2. Regularly test security systems and processes

Maintain Information Security Policy

  1. Maintain a policy that addresses information security

Compliance Levels

Level 1: > 6 million transactions/year (annual ROC required) Level 2: 1-6 million transactions/year (annual SAQ) Level 3: 20,000-1 million e-commerce transactions/year Level 4: < 20,000 e-commerce or < 1 million total transactions

Data Minimization (Never Store)

# NEVER STORE THESE
PROHIBITED_DATA = {
    'full_track_data': 'Magnetic stripe data',
    'cvv': 'Card verification code/value',
    'pin': 'PIN or PIN block'
}

# CAN STORE (if encrypted)
ALLOWED_DATA = {
    'pan': 'Primary Account Number (card number)',
    'cardholder_name': 'Name on card',
    'expiration_date': 'Card expiration',
    'service_code': 'Service code'
}

class PaymentData:
    """Safe payment data handling."""

    def __init__(self):
        self.prohibited_fields = ['cvv', 'cvv2', 'cvc', 'pin']

    def sanitize_log(self, data):
        """Remove sensitive data from logs."""
        sanitized = data.copy()

        # Mask PAN
        if 'card_number' in sanitized:
            card = sanitized['card_number']
            sanitized['card_number'] = f"{card[:6]}{'*' * (len(card) - 10)}{card[-4:]}"

        # Remove prohibited data
        for field in self.prohibited_fields:
            sanitized.pop(field, None)

        return sanitized

    def validate_no_prohibited_storage(self, data):
        """Ensure no prohibited data is being stored."""
        for field in self.prohibited_fields:
            if field in data:
                raise SecurityError(f"Attempting to store prohibited field: {field}")
